Gravity dispense at Craft 100, CBC Clapham, 03/04/14. Very lightly hazed golden yellow, moderate off white spotting. Nose is lemon rind, tangerine, straw, peach, melon. Taste comprises straw, earthy, farmyard, light peach, pinch of spice, melon, light bread dough. Medium bodied, fine carbonation, semi drying close. Solid low ABV saison, plenty of flavour for 4.5% !

Cask at Craft 100. It pours hazy pale gold with a medium white head. The nose is toasty, sweet dough, light spice, orange peel and herbal notes. The taste is crisp, bitter, doughy, grass, orange peel, lemony soap, grapefruit and herbal with a bitter, somewhat citric finish. Medium body and fine carbonation. All comes together rather well. Rather nice.
